雅居投資控股(08426.HK)中期純利升14.3%至477.5萬港元
格隆匯 8 月 10日丨雅居投資控股(08426.HK)公佈,截至2020年6月30日止6個月,實現收益2.06億港元,同比增加約0.2%;期內溢利477.5萬港元,同比增加約14.3%;每股基本盈利為0.6港仙。
於2020年6月30日,集團的現有物業管理組合包括香港房屋委員會擁有的28個公共屋邨、房委會授出的4個居屋計劃屋苑及2份獨立服務合約,均由集團管理。於2019年第四季度,集團的九個公共屋邨合約屆滿,而一份包括九個公共屋邨的新合約於2020年第二季度開始時開展。
收入增加乃歸因於來自房委會擁有的公共屋邨的新合約的額外服務費收入;及根據該等合約所訂的調整機制上調集團部分現有合約的服務費。純利增加主要由於新合約的溢利率;及處理向僱員支付的政府補貼的行政收入增加所致。
